Job Purpose:
To support the MoHR Helpline 1099 by analyzing data on human rights violations reported by victims, particularly focusing on Gender-Based Violence (GBV) and other vulnerable groups. This analysis will inform strategic decision-making, program development, and advocacy efforts to promote and protect human rights in Pakistan.
Qualification, Experience & Skills:
- Master's preferable a PhD degree in Social Sciences, Gender or a related field.
- Minimum 7 years of experience in data analysis and research, preferably in human rights context.
- Strong analytical skills with proficiency in statistical software (e.g., SPSS, R).
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English and Urdu.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Strong understanding of human rights principles and issues in Pakistan.
- Experience working with sensitive data is a strong asset.
Job Description:
Specific Responsibilities:
- Data Collection and Management:
- Collaborate with Helpline 1099 staff to ensure consistent data collection on reported human rights violations.
- Develop and implement data quality control procedures to maintain data accuracy and integrity.
- Clean, organize, and prepare helpline data for analysis.
- Data Analysis:
- Conduct in-depth analysis of helpline data to identify trends, patterns, and key demographics related to human rights violations, with a specific focus on GBV and vulnerable groups.
- Utilize appropriate statistical software and techniques to analyze data (e.g., SPSS, R).
- Develop reports, presentations, and visualizations to effectively communicate findings to stakeholders.
- Research and Reporting:
- Conduct research on best practices in data analysis for human rights reporting.
- Prepare reports on the nature and scope of human rights violations reported to the helpline.
- Contribute to the development of research studies and reports related to human rights issues in Pakistan.
- Advocacy and Capacity Building:
- Work with Helpline staff to translate data analysis findings into actionable recommendations for policy and program development.
- Support advocacy efforts to raise awareness of human rights violations and promote effective interventions.
- Contribute to capacity building initiatives for Helpline staff on data collection and analysis methods.
